Output aaceb846329a8dbfbb75e260acf452a0e042aa7cebb4e804d506018c47d64869:2

value
17678448
script pubkey
OP_0 OP_PUSHBYTES_20 453fcf81b8bcc5423becbb82a87ca7073b44e7a7
address
bc1qg5lulqdchnz5ywlvhwp2sl98qua5fea8rkm6ln
transaction
aaceb846329a8dbfbb75e260acf452a0e042aa7cebb4e804d506018c47d64869